Alex Ovechkin scored his 900th career goal as the Washington Capitals defeated the visiting St. Louis Blues 6-1 on Wednesday.
Anthony Beauvillier and Tom Wilson each scored two goals, and John Carlson had a goal and an assist as the Capitals snapped a four-game winless streak.
Jakob Chychrun recorded three assists for Washington and goaltender Logan Thompson made 23 saves.
Alexey Toropchenko scored for the slumping Blues, who are 1-6-2 in their last nine games.
Blues goaltender Jordan Binnington allowed four goals on 15 shots before giving way to Joel Hofer midway through the game.
Ovechkin set up his league-record 900th goal by knocking down an outlet attempt by Binnington early in the second period. When Chychrun's ensuing shot caromed to him off the end boards, Ovechkin scored on a spinning backhand from a bad angle before Binnington could get to the post.
Beauvillier increased Washington's lead to 3-0 at the 4:33 mark of the period by cutting to his backhand and lifting a shot past Binnington.
Carlson made it 4-0 at 9:28 of the second by stealing the puck inside the St. Louis blue line and scoring with a turnaround shot from the slot.
Beauvillier pushed the lead to 5-0 at 16:20 by beating Hofer over his shoulder on the short side from the left circle.
Toropchenko got the Blues on the scoreboard by scoring short-handed 37 seconds into the third period.
But Wilson crashed the net for a rebound conversion at 9:00 to extend Washington's lead to 6-1.
The Capitals controlled the first period while outshooting the Blues 12-5 and taking a 1-0 lead.
Washington pinned the exhausted Blues in their own zone during a three-shift sequence, firing away at Binnington until they finally drew a penalty. The Capitals converted their man advantage when Carlson fired a slap shot and Wilson deflected it past Binnington.
